在業界打滾的這兩年,由於開發項目幾乎都是使用Java搭配Spring Boot框架進行開發,我也因此積累了一些Spring Boot的相關技術知識。 回顧過去,...
Spring Boot是基於Spring FrameWork 4.0 而衍生的,它主要為了簡化使用Spring框架的難度(建立、執行、除錯、部署等)以及繁雜的依...
在我們繼續深入Spring Boot前,我想先花一點時間介紹Maven。建構和依賴管理是Spring Boot重要的一環,它之所以能夠自動引入相依套件,主要得益...
昨天,我們介紹了Maven對於專案建置的重要性,也稍微說明了pom.xml內部分元素的意義,今天讓我們來繼續了解pom.xml內相依性(也稱依賴, Depend...
在了解完Maven專案的核心檔案pom.xml後,我們可以了解到在專案開發階段如果要引用相依套件時該如何設定。此外,我也想藉此機會介紹一下Maven的其中一個核...
說完了建置 Spring Boot 專案背後重要的功臣之一——Maven後,讓我們繼續回到Spring Boot,來好好聊一下 Spring Boot 的核心設...
依賴注入(Dependency Injection, DI),這裡要先聲明,依賴注入不是Spring Boot專有,它是一種設計模式。那麼,這種設計模式的意義、...
注入(Injection)可以理解為實現”依賴”的過程,簡單的說法就是,要怎麼樣讓物件B可以給物件A使用。注入方式有三種: 1. 建構式注入 (Construc...
Bean 代表的是由 IoC 容器(IoC Container)管理的Java物件,這些物件構成了程式的邏輯,並且在整個專案中,可以被不同的 Class 分享&...
昨天介紹了 Bean的配置 方式,接下來打算介紹基於註解配置中的一些Bean,但在介紹今天的Bean前,需要先稍微介紹一下在Spring Boot內的一種架構模...